What does salt do to an empty stomach? Effects, Risks, and Considerations

4 min read

According to a study published by the National Institutes of Health, high dietary salt intake is positively associated with an increased risk of gastric cancer due to its damaging effect on the stomach lining over time. However, the immediate effects of consuming salt on an empty stomach vary drastically depending on the quantity ingested.

Understanding the Science: A Pinch vs. a Flush

The impact of salt on an empty stomach is highly dependent on the dose. There is a world of difference between a tiny pinch of high-quality mineral salt and the large, concentrated amount used in a salt water flush. This distinction is crucial for understanding the potential outcomes, ranging from minor digestive support to serious health complications.

The Osmotic Effect of a Salt Water Flush

A large dose of salt dissolved in water creates a hypertonic solution. When consumed on an empty stomach, this high salt concentration triggers a process called osmosis, pulling a significant amount of water from the body's tissues into the intestinal tract. This influx of fluid serves as a powerful, non-absorbable laxative, stimulating rapid and often urgent bowel movements within a short period. This practice is often referred to as a "salt water cleanse" or "flush" and is not a scientifically supported detox method for regular use.

The Digestive Role of Chloride

For a small, controlled amount of salt, the effect is different. Salt is composed of sodium and chloride. Chloride is a crucial component for producing hydrochloric acid, a primary component of stomach acid necessary for proper digestion. Some people with low stomach acid levels might use a pinch of salt water to aid in digestion, but this is a very different practice from a full flush.

Regulating Electrolytes and Hydration

Sodium is a vital electrolyte, essential for nerve function, muscle contraction, and maintaining proper fluid balance. A very small amount of mineral-rich salt, like Himalayan or Celtic sea salt, is sometimes added to water to help replenish electrolytes lost during exercise or to enhance hydration. This is far different from a high-dose flush, which can cause the rapid expulsion of fluids and electrolytes, leading to imbalance and dehydration.

The High-Risk Side: What Happens with Too Much Salt?

Excessive salt intake, especially on an empty stomach, poses several significant health risks. This is particularly true for the high-concentration "salt water flush" practices.

  • Nausea and Vomiting: The body recognizes the extremely high salt concentration and may reject it through nausea and vomiting. This is a common side effect of salt flushes.
  • Dehydration and Electrolyte Imbalance: Paradoxically, while a salt water flush pulls water into the colon, it can cause overall dehydration and disturb the body's electrolyte balance. The rapid loss of fluids and key minerals can lead to serious health issues, including muscle spasms, weakness, and confusion.
  • Cardiovascular Strain: For those with existing conditions like hypertension (high blood pressure) or heart problems, a high sodium load on an empty stomach is particularly dangerous. The excess sodium can worsen these conditions and may even trigger an irregular heartbeat.
  • Gastric Mucosal Damage: Over the long term, a high salt diet can damage the stomach's protective mucosal lining. This damage can increase susceptibility to inflammation and potentially raise the risk of stomach cancer, especially in combination with H. pylori infection. A case study has even shown severe corrosive gastritis from the ingestion of crystalline sodium chloride.

The Risks of Salt Water Flushes: A Comparison

It is critical to distinguish between the moderate intake of trace minerals and the aggressive practice of a saltwater cleanse. The table below highlights the stark differences in purpose, amount, and potential health outcomes.

Feature Pinch of Mineral Salt in Water High-Dose Salt Water Flush
Purpose Hydration, Mineral Replenishment, Digestive Support Laxative effect, Colon cleanse
Amount of Salt Very small (e.g., 1/8 to 1/4 tsp) Large (e.g., 2 tsp or more)
Effect on Bowels Mild or no effect on most people Strong, urgent, and multiple bowel movements
Primary Risks Low risk for healthy individuals when done in moderation High risk: dehydration, severe cramping, nausea, electrolyte imbalance, dangerous for those with certain health issues
Medical Support Generally a safer practice for general wellness, consult a doctor if unsure Limited to no scientific support for health claims, high-risk practice

Conclusion: Caution is Key

While a small pinch of mineral-rich salt in water on an empty stomach may be considered safe for healthy individuals and is anecdotally associated with supporting hydration, the overall practice of consuming salt on an empty stomach must be approached with caution. The potential benefits are minor and often unproven, while the risks associated with larger, unmonitored doses, like those in a salt water flush, can be severe and dangerous. The human body has its own efficient, natural detoxification systems involving the liver and kidneys; relying on aggressive methods like a salt water flush is unnecessary and can be harmful. Always consult a healthcare provider, especially if you have pre-existing conditions like high blood pressure, kidney disease, or diabetes, before trying any new health ritual.
